    Why are Finns happier than Swedes? In terms of society, we are quite similar countries, so there is no big difference. So as a Finn, I answer that wars and history are the reason and the distinguishing factor. Because of the past, Finns are less satisfied and value more the basic things in life, such as independence, freedom and life in general.

      @@TheEliplanet Thanks. ❤️ Time will tell if this will change in the future as time passes. If we are honest, Finland has always had to fight for its independence. We have always been our own people, with our own language and culture. But still, Finland has only been independent for more than 100 years. It's a short time in history. So from a historical point of view it is still fresh in our memory. Will it still be like that 100 years from now? I hope so, because the sacrifices have been hard for the grandparents. And history tends to repeat itself if it is forgotten.
